Breaking Down the Features of Tru-Spec 24-7 2-Ply Range Belt, Black, L 4091005 – 1 out of 8 models
Specifications
Width: The belt is 1.75 inches wide. This width is ideal for fitting through most standard belt loops on tactical pants and jeans.
This width provides a stable platform for attaching holsters and other gear.Material: Constructed from 2-ply durable fade & rip-resistant nylon. This nylon construction ensures the belt can withstand rigorous use and exposure to the elements.
This construction resists fraying, stretching, and fading over time.Buckle: Features a high-strength anodized aluminum buckle. Aluminum is lightweight and strong, making it an ideal material for a belt buckle.
The anodized finish provides corrosion and scratch resistance.Finish: The buckle has a color matched matte finish. This matte finish reduces glare and blends seamlessly with the black nylon webbing.
A low-profile appearance is ideal for tactical applications.Construction: Includes heavy stitched reinforcements. Reinforced stitching at key stress points enhances the belt’s durability and longevity.
These reinforcements prevent the belt from tearing or unraveling under heavy loads.Tip: A tapered, low profile tip makes insertion into the buckle easy and enhances comfort. This thoughtful design detail prevents the tip from digging into your side.

Pros and Cons of Tru-Spec 24-7 2-Ply Range Belt, Black, L 4091005 – 1 out of 8 models
Pros
- Exceptional Durability: The 2-ply nylon and aluminum buckle are built to withstand heavy use and harsh conditions.
- Stable Platform: Provides a rock-solid base for attaching holsters, magazine pouches, and other gear.
- Affordable Price: Offers excellent value for money compared to other tactical belts on the market.
- Low-Profile Design: The matte black finish and simple design make it suitable for both tactical and everyday wear.
- Compatible with Most Accessories: The 1.75-inch width is compatible with a wide range of MOLLE and belt-mounted accessories.
Cons
- The belt is rigid, which may not be comfortable for all-day wear.
- The buckle design is simple and lacks advanced features like quick-release mechanisms.
